Those who canvass for freedom say that a necessary part of freedom isequality. But it is strange logic nat equality has to be established for edom to come, and that freedom has be sacrificed for the sake of equality he truth is, once freedom is lost, who ill restore it? People forget that the person who ill make them all equal will himself mean free and unequal; he will remain outside of them all. He will have no utters on his feet and, he will have a gun his hand. Now you can well envision a ociety where most people are in hackles, and a handful are free and powerful with all modern instruments suppression and oppression at their sposal. What can you do in a situation ek this? Marx said that in order to achieve quality in society first, suppress political freedom, destroy individual liberty andestablish a dictatorship. And he thought that after the achievement of equality, freedom would be restored to the people. But what we see is that as the power of those who govern us grows, and as the people, the 'ruled', aresystema- tically suppressed and debilitated, the hope for freedom becomes increasingly dim. Then it is difficult even to raise the question of freedom. Nobody dares ask a question, speak his thoughts, much less dissented rebel against the establishment In the name of equality, and under cover of equality, freedom could get destroyed; then it will be nearly impossible to win it back-because those who destroy freedom will see to it that the chances of its being revived inthe future are also destroyed. Secondly, while freedom is an absolutely natural phenomenon, which everyone must have as his right, equality isnot. Equality is neither natural nor possible. All people cannot be equal because they are basically unequal. But everyone should be free to be what he is and what he can be; to be himself. If equality is forced on people then their freedom is bound to diminish and disappear. Anything imposed with force is synonymous with slavery. Only free individuals make a society and where sovereignty of the individual is denied, society turns into a herd, a mob. This is the difference between society and crowd. Society is another name for the interrelationship of individuals, a cooperative of individuals-but the individual has to be there, he is the basic unit of society. There cannot be a society inside a all prison; a prison can only have a crowca collection of faceless individuals. Prisoners also relate with each other, exchanging greetings and gifts among themselves, but they are definitely no society. They have just been gathered together and forced to live within the four walls of a prison; it is not their free choice. Evil wants to destroy the individuaseen as a thorn in its flesh. It wants the crowd, the mass to live and grow. Goodon the contrary, accepts the individuaand wants him to grow to his supremefulfillment and, at the same time, it wants the crowd to disappear gradual from the scene. Good stands for a socieof free individuals. Individuals will, ocourse, have relationships, butthen itwill be a society and not a herd, not a crowd.
